Outside the center of Prague lies hidden on the backside of Hotel Schwaiger an extensive garden restaurant. Its specialty is grilled food, prepared in the garden itself. The ordered food was excellent, service good and prices moderate. Definitely recommended to visit if one has a...car and find a parking place in the front of the hotel.More

We, as others, got the recommendation from their "sister" hotel (Pod Vezi) staff that the food was terrific, and it was....They have their own small "meat smoker" and the smoked ribs were fabulous. This restaurant and and hotel are up above the Castle near many of the embassies in a forrested, residential area (so a bit too far to walk to for most people) but well worth the taxi ride up and back. No city views just a nice outdoor patio for better weather dining and happy hours as well as the inside dining area.More
